On Fri, Feb 29, 2008 at 02:20:52PM -0600, Robert Citek wrote:
> On Fri, Feb 29, 2008 at 1:53 PM, Larry Brigman <larry.brigman at gmail.com> wrote:
> > I don't know why this is not in LSB spec. Probably should be.
>
> $ cat /etc/lsb-release
>
> Also:
>
> $ lsb_release -a
or:
$ lsb_release -h
usage: lsb_release [options]
options:
-h, --help show this help message and exit
-v, --version show LSB modules this system supports
-i, --id show distributor ID
-d, --description show description of this distribution
-r, --release show release number of this distribution
-c, --codename show code name of this distribution
-a, --all show all of the above information
-s, --short show all of the above information in short format
or for what Paul wanted:
$ lsb_release -rc
Description: Ubuntu 6.06.2 LTS
Codename: dapper
